Exploring Ideal Settings and Historic Estates

When it comes to seeking inspiration, tranquility, and a glimpse into the past, historic estates provide the perfect combination of beauty and history in an ideal setting. These grand homes, often surrounded by lush gardens and picturesque landscapes, offer visitors a chance to immerse themselves in a bygone era while enjoying the beauty of their surroundings.

Why Visit Historic Estates?

Historic estates serve as a window to the past, allowing visitors to explore the architecture, art, and lifestyle of previous eras. These properties are often meticulously preserved, offering a glimpse into the lives of the people who once called them home. Additionally, many historic estates are set in stunning locations, providing visitors with a tranquil escape from the hustle and bustle of modern life.

Top Historic Estates to Explore

  1. Biltmore Estate, North Carolina, USA

    Known as America's largest home, the Biltmore Estate boasts breathtaking architecture, stunning gardens, and a rich history dating back to the Gilded Age. Visitors can tour the opulent rooms of the mansion, explore the expansive grounds, and enjoy wine tastings at the estate's vineyard.

    Biltmore Estate
  2. Château de Versailles, France

    A symbol of French royalty and opulence, the Château de Versailles is a UNESCO World Heritage site that showcases the grandeur of the French monarchy. Visitors can marvel at the Hall of Mirrors, stroll through the manicured gardens, and learn about the history of this iconic palace.

    Château de Versailles
  3. Highclere Castle, England

    Famous as the filming location for the hit TV series Downton Abbey, Highclere Castle is a stunning estate set amidst rolling English countryside. Visitors can explore the lavish rooms of the castle, wander through the beautiful gardens, and learn about the real-life history of this historic property.

Tips for Visiting Historic Estates

  • Check the estate's website for visitor information, tour schedules, and ticket prices.
  • Wear comfortable shoes for exploring expansive grounds and grand interiors.
  • Take your time to soak in the beauty and history of each estate, and don't forget to capture memorable moments with your camera.
  • Support the preservation efforts of these historic properties by purchasing souvenirs or making donations.
